Customer Service: We travelled 75 kms for a special dinner. I called in to book a table and I was told "Today is Tuesday so we will not be busy, no booking needed". When I insisted that without booking I am not driving over an hour to come to your place my details were taken for a booking at 07:30 pm.
I reach the restaurant at 7:27 pm with a party of 6 people. The restaurant was jam packed with people. I was asked to wait and by the time the table was provided it was 7:52 pm. When I asked "what happened to my booking, I see no table with 'Reserved' sign on it" the response was really frustrating from the staff "You called us at 04:52 pm while we open at 05:00 pm was we misplaced your booking.
This is very disappointing. When you advise your customer that the booking is taken, the customer expects a table for them.
Food: Food as seen in pictures ( I did forget to picture all items) was good when you consider all chats (5 tried) and Indo-Chinese food (4 tried). The curries (Dal tadka and Methi Malai Mutter Panner) had room for improvement. Dal Tadka was missing the second tadka. Thus, had no lusture or that kick. Rotis were great. Drinks were really good too. Thus, the food is acceptable and will become great.
Design Issues: The place looks great but the way few things are applied is questionable and results in hard life for staff and also customers. [1] No Pull/Push sign on the door. I observed 5 Adults and 3 kids getting this mixed up. It is a low cost but effective way to make people feel good.
[2] No waiting area for customers while busy/ No designated area for delivery drivers While we were waiting there were 13 people at the door in less than 4 meter area. They have a lot of extra chairs on level 1 and all needs to be done is to ask staff to direct the waiting people on level 1. Put 2 or 3 chairs under the stairs for delivery drivers to wait with proper signage.
[3] An innovative way for staff to get the food upstairs. I did notice some staff very uncomfortable on stairs with food. If this is done then, they can have 2 very nice...
